Citrus growers who’ve lost acreage to greening, canker and freezes were among those attending a September meeting in Sebring about biofuel crops. In this interview, growers Mark and David Wheeler and Charlie Roper say they’re looking for possible crops to grow on vacant land. Florida’s Fresh Citrus Packinghouses Are Shipping Fruit
Citrus Administrative Committee Manager Duke Chadwell reports that the fresh citrus season has begun. He tells what varieties are being packed and how the fresh citrus season is likely to progress. Citrus Research Board To Hold Contests To Find HLB Solutions
Citrus Research and Development Foundation Chief Operating Officer Dan Gunter reports on contests the foundation will hold in an effort to find intermediate solutions to HLB. Extension Agent: Young Trees Can Be Grown In Face Of HLB
Ryan Atwood, one of the citrus Extension agents addressing a series of seminars around the citrus belt, says young trees can be grown even when greening disease is present. Rooney Updates Citrus League On ‘Partnership’ & Water Rules
Congressman Tom Rooney, a member of the House Agriculture Committee, in the first report talks about his “partnership” with growers who need help on federal issues. In the second report, he offers an update on the EPA’s pending numeric nutrient criteria for Florida waters. His comments came at the recent Indian River Citrus League annual meeting.
